The Advanced Certificate in Solar Energy for Smart Education equips participants with the knowledge and skills to design, implement, and manage solar energy systems within educational settings. This program emphasizes practical application and cutting-edge technologies, making it highly relevant to the growing renewable energy sector.
Learning outcomes include a comprehensive understanding of photovoltaic (PV) systems, solar thermal technologies, and energy storage solutions. Participants will gain proficiency in solar energy system design software, energy auditing techniques, and the economic analysis of solar projects. Successful completion demonstrates expertise in sustainable energy practices crucial for smart campuses.
The program's duration is typically six months, delivered through a flexible online format. This allows working professionals and educators to seamlessly integrate the course into their existing schedules. The curriculum combines online lectures, practical exercises, and interactive projects to ensure effective learning and skill development.
